About
Highly analytical and results-driven B.Tech student specializing in Information Technology, with a strong foundation in full-stack development and AI/ML. Proven ability to design and implement scalable solutions, optimize system performance, and lead technical initiatives, as demonstrated by significant contributions to open-source projects (Google Summer of Code) and innovative personal ventures. Eager to leverage expertise in React, NestJS, Python, and C++ to solve complex challenges and drive impactful outcomes in a dynamic software engineering environment.
Work
Mumbai, Maharashtra, India
→
Summary
As a Full Stack Intern at Steps AI, Sharan is actively contributing to the development of robust web applications and comprehensive B2B solutions.
Highlights
Designed and developed a reusable UI component library, ensuring consistency and accelerating development across all web applications.
Maintained the NestJS backend and implemented Role-Based Access Control (RBAC) for secure API access, enhancing system security and data integrity.
Architected and delivered a complete B2B multi-tenant solution, incorporating custom domain and subdomain support for enhanced client segmentation and scalability.
Remote, Virtual, US
→
Summary
Contributed to NumFOCUS as a Google Summer of Code participant, focusing on enhancing data visualization and workflow analysis tools for complex computational workflows.
Highlights
Designed and launched a React-based tool for browsing AiiDA graphs and databases, improving the speed index by 44.3% and user experience.
Expanded node capacity from 10 to over 40, enabling deeper analysis of complex computational workflows and improving data processing capabilities.
Optimized algorithms to achieve a 54.5% reduction in CPU time, significantly enhancing system efficiency and resource utilization.
Achieved a 61.1% reduction in page weight, leading to significantly faster load times and improved application performance.
Volunteer
Community of Coders, VJTI
|Dev Head
→
Summary
Leads technical initiatives and fosters a collaborative coding environment for students at Veermata Jijabai Technological Institute.
Highlights
Organized coding competitions and workshops for over 100 members, actively encouraging collaboration and skill development within the student community.
Led a team of 25 individuals to successfully conduct events that involved the participation of more than 160 students, demonstrating strong leadership and event management skills.
Awards
Hackathon Winner (AI/ML Domain)
Awarded By
Not Specified
Won a hackathon in the AI/ML domain, showcasing innovative skills in developing intuitive UI and robust backend APIs for a cutting-edge solution.
Languages
English
Skills
Programming Languages
Python, C++, JavaScript, SQL, JAVA.
Web Technologies
Next.js, React.js, Express.js, Flask, Node.js, Tailwind CSS, HTML, Nest.js, UI Component Libraries, API Development, RBAC.
Databases
MongoDB, MySQL, PostgreSQL.
Tools & Platforms
Docker, CI/CD, Linux, Git, GitHub, Google Cloud Platform (GCP).
AI/ML & Data Science
AI/ML, Gemini, Huggingface, Algorithm Optimization, Data Visualization, Computational Workflows.
Software Development
Full Stack Development, Backend Development, Frontend Development, Multi-tenant Architecture, System Design, Code Generation, Debugging, Problem Solving (500+ Leetcode problems).